#5a3036 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5a3036 is composed of 35.3% red, 18.8% green and 21.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 46.7% magenta, 40% yellow and 64.7% black. It has a hue angle of 351.4 degrees, a saturation of 30.4% and a lightness of 27.1%. #5a3036 color hex could be obtained by blending #b4606c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

#5a3036 color description : Very dark desaturated red.

#5a3036 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#5a3036 has RGB values of R:90, G:48, B:54 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.47, Y:0.4, K:0.65. Its decimal value is 5910582.

Shades and Tints of #5a3036

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f8f3f3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#5a3036

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4a4041 is the less saturated color, while #8a0014 is the most saturated one.
